Key Duties & Responsibilities
- Produce and revise detailed 2D and 3D engineering drawings using SolidWorks and AutoCAD for bespoke architectural metalwork, modular systems, and OEM products.
- Assist the estimating and sales teams with material take-offs, preliminary design reviews, cost estimates, and preparation of customer quotations.
- Support project delivery by generating and managing works orders, bills of materials, and production documentation within Statii ERP.
- Maintain accurate batch traceability, material allocations, drawing revisions, and production records in line with company quality procedures.
- Record and allocate engineering and design hours accurately to projects to support commercial tracking and operational efficiency.
- Liaise directly with customer design managers, architects, project managers, and internal production teams to coordinate technical requirements and resolve design queries.
- Support the development and standardisation of modular and OEM product ranges through repeatable design systems, libraries, and lean engineering processes.
- Assist with continuous improvement initiatives within the design office, including document control, workflow optimisation, and design automation opportunities.
- Participate in site visits, production reviews, and project coordination meetings to develop practical understanding of fabrication and installation processes.
- Contribute to a collaborative, hands-on engineering environment while developing technical, commercial, and project management skills across the business.
